It's amazing what we don't know until we truly know it.... In this case, that happens within the true of story of Marie Curie and her husband discovering the radioactive properties of Radium. The fact that they didn't see the dangers of handling radioactive elements for so long is mind boggling in retrospect and makes you wonder how many dangerous materials do we handle and ingest today? Probably a lot. Overall, the movie is fascinating, but it's also a bit bleak and slow as it chronicles the health problems that the Curie family develop and both the good and truly evil ways in which radioactivity goes on to be used for.
